Exam 1 Question and Answers
General definition of nursing - answerthe protection, promotion, and optimization of
health abilities, prevention of illness and injury, alleviation of suffering through the
diagnosis and treatment of human response, and advocacy in the care of individuals,
families, communities, and populations
Art of nursing - answer- caring and respect for human dignity
- embraces spirituality, healing, empathy, respect, and compassion
- protection, promotion and optimization of health
- alleviation of suffering
- facilitation of healing
- prevention or resolution of disease
- transition to a dignified death
Science of nursing - answerquantitative and qualitative evidence, guide policies and
practices, use nursing process as analytical thinking framework
Basic roles and responsibilities of the ANA - answerAmerican nurses Association; they
develop the scope and standards of practice, develop and maintain the scope of
practice statement and standards that apply the practice, and serve as a template for
evaluation of nursing speciality practice
Purpose of the ANA scopes and standards of practice - answerdescribes the who, what,
when, where, why, and how of nursing practice
Purpose of the ANA code of ethics for nurses - answerstatement of the professionals'
values and beliefs, which are based on ethical principles
- ethical framework in nursing regardless of practice
- expresses values, virtues, and obligations
Provision 1 Code of Ethics for Nurses - answerthe nurse practices with compassion and
respect for the inherent dignity, worth, and unique attributes of every person
Provision 1 - answer- 1.1 respect for human dignity
- 1.2 relationships with patients
- 1.3 the nature of heath
- 1.4 the right to self determination
- 1.5 relationships with colleagues
